Description
Phocas (AD 602-610). AV solidus (21mm, 4.40 gm, 7h). NGC MS 4/5 - 3/5, edge wrinkle. Constantinople, 5th officina, AD 607-610. D N FOCAS-PЄRP AVG, draped, cuirassed bust of Phocas facing, wearing crown surmounted by cross, with globus cruciger in right hand / VICTORIA-AVϚЧ Є, Angel standing facing, grounded staff surmounted by staurogram in right hand, globus cruciger in outstretched left; CONOB in exergue. Sear 620.From the Werner Collection.
